The People Who Do the Work


Behind every install and repair is a crew that handles the details that make a gutter system last. The team includes installers and service technicians who work across the Atlanta area throughout the year.


Members of the team, including Steve, Gabe, Jay, and others, bring hands-on experience to each project. That experience shows up in the small things, such as setting the correct pitch, spacing hangers properly, and checking the fascia before new gutters go on.


It is the difference between a system that simply looks finished and one that moves water the way it should.

The Areas We Serve Around Atlanta


Gutters 4 Less serves homeowners across Metro Atlanta and the surrounding communities, including Buford, Cumming, Alpharetta, and the greater Atlanta area. Working across the region means the team understands the local mix of tree cover, older neighborhoods, and newer

construction.


That local knowledge matters because gutter needs are not the same from one part of the metro to the next. A home surrounded by pines has different demands than one on an open lot, and our crews see both regularly.
